Somebody with a better grasp of all of this is going to have to explain why it's a good idea or necessary to ban private insurance for those willing to pay for it.
His plan is more generous than the others. He didn’t say other countries have passed my bill. He said they have universal healthcare, which really is the first column
They still allow supplemental coverage for things like cosmetics, but:
Administrative costs make up for something like 25% of the cost of services right now, with hospitals having dedicated staff for billing/coding for various insurers. You drastically simplify that process and can attack cost there. They no longer need a collections department, etc.
you eliminate the concept of anybody being out of network. By having other plans, providers can just say... yeah we’re not gonna accept Medicare. When i was living in LA i had to drive to Lancaster to find a specialist covered in my plan. I’m sure others have had it worse
That also gives greater leverage to negotiate costs of services and drugs if they’re the only game in town. Though drug prices can alternatively be regulated through legislation
